The result of revenue minus expenses is profit. Profits are earned when goods or services are sold for more than they cost to produce. The single contract in our revenue example was valued at $50,000.
Net Profit Margin = (Net Profit / Revenue) x 100 To calculate the net profit margin, divide the net profit by total revenue and multiply by 100 to express the value as a percentage.
